From: Ed Knowles <>
Date: Sat, 8 Feb 1997 17:35:14 -0400

G'day Andreas!

Andreas Jung wrote:
> the Changelog of Squid 1.1.6 mentions Splay tree for fast IP access
> What does it mean exactly ?

The structure used to hold the src type acl's has been changed from a linked
list, that places the last requested acl into the second place of the list,
into a splay tree.

A splay tree is a type of balanced tree, but it is self adjusting. The last
requested acl is placed at the root of the tree. A neat Java demo and further
explanation can be found at:

It has been #ifdef out as there appeares to be an, as yet, unsolved bug :(

Any feedback would be greatly appreciated.


